The Kyle City Council is currently accepting applications to allocate $30,000 set aside from this year’s budget to support service organizations in Kyle, city officials say.
Applications should be submitted to the city secretary by noon on July 1 and can be downloaded from the city’s website at www.cityofkyle.com. The forms are also available at Kyle City Hall and Kyle Public Library or may be requested by calling city staff at 262-1010.
To qualify, organizations must provide services directly to the citizens of Kyle. Final recommendations regarding the allocation of funds will be made by the Community Relations Committee and presented to the city council, officials say.
The council is scheduled to hear the recommendations and make final decisions on allocating the funds at its council meeting on July 20, officials say.
